spur

[spə:]

n.支脈,刺激, 馬刺, 鞭策 
vt.刺激, 鞭策,促進

例句與用法:

She went to London on the spur of the moment.

她一時興起就到倫敦去了。

What spurred her to do that?

是什麼促使她那麼幹的?

International competition was a spur to modernization.

國際競爭是實現現代化的動力。

He dug in his spurs.

他用靴刺踢馬。

詞形變化:

動詞過去式: spurred | 動詞過去分詞: spurred | 動詞現在分詞: spurring | 動詞第三人稱單數: spurs |

英文解釋:

名詞 spur:


a verbalization that encourages you to attempt something

同義詞:goadgoadingprodproddingurgingspurring


any sharply pointed projection

同義詞:spineacantha


tubular extension at the base of the corolla in some flowers

a sharp prod fixed to a rider's heel and used to urge a horse onward

同義詞:gad


a railway line connected to a trunk line

同義詞:branch linespur track



動詞 spur:


incite or stimulate

give heart or courage to

同義詞:goad


strike with a spur

goad with spurs

equip with spurs
